What is the cheapest Dortmund to Bosnia and Herzegovina flight route?

The cheapest ticket to Bosnia and Herzegovina from Dortmund found in the last 5 days was to Tuzla, at 60 € return. The most popular route is from Dortmund (DTM) to Banja Luka (BNX), and the cheapest return airline ticket found on this route in the last 5 days was 98 €.

What is the cheapest month to fly from Dortmund to Bosnia and Herzegovina?

The cheapest month for flights from Dortmund to Bosnia and Herzegovina is February, when tickets cost 50 € (return) on average. On the other hand, the most expensive months are July and December, when the average cost of return tickets is 209 € and 200 € respectively.

  • What is the Hacker Fare option on flights from Dortmund to Bosnia and Herzegovina?

    Hacker Fares allow you to combine one-way tickets in order to save you money over a traditional return ticket. You could then fly from Dortmund to Bosnia and Herzegovina with an airline and back with another airline.

  • What is KAYAK's "flexible dates" feature and why should I care when looking for a flight from Dortmund to Bosnia and Herzegovina?

    Sometimes travel dates aren't set in stone. If your preferred travel dates have some wiggle room, flexible dates will show you all the options when flying from Dortmund to Bosnia and Herzegovina up to 3 days before/after your preferred dates. You can then pick the flights that suit you best.
